NBA Icon Chris Paul Becomes Investor in “Global Impact Brand” Wicked Kitchen

Reading Time: 2 minutes



Plant-based CPG brand Wicked Kitchen announces basketball superstar Chris Paul has joined the company as an investor. Paul joined the brand after originally investing in alt-seafood startup Current Foods, which Wicked Kitchen acquired in May.

A 10-time NBA All-Star, Paul transitioned to a plant-based diet in 2019 and credits the change with enhancing his on-court performance and improving his recovery time. Paul has become a passionate advocate for the vegan lifestyle and also invested in plant-based brands Umaro Foods, Misha’s, and Koia protein shakes. 
In 2022, Paul partnered with delivery service GoPuff to launch his own line of plant-based chips and snacks, Good Eat’n.

Accelerating growth
With one of the plant-based industry’s most extensive ranges of packaged foods, Wicked Foods’ products can currently be found at  90,000 distribution points in the US and UK.  In addition to retail, Wicked Kitchen is expanding its presence in food service, debuting its first plant-based concession stand at the Target Center in Minneapolis and partnering with ASM Global to increase vegan food options across ASM’s network of arenas, stadiums and convention centers. 
Over the past 12 months, the company has continued to accelerate its size and growth by acquiring Good Catch and Current Foods, both of which produce plant-based seafood alternatives.

Other high-profile investors in Wicked Kitchen include actor Woody Harrelson, Paris Hilton, musician Lance Bass and actress Shailene Woodley. The company has raised over $20M in funding.
